WebJun 19, 2024 · COVID-19, flu (influenza), and RSV (Respiratory Syncytial Virus) are all contagious respiratory illnesses but are caused by different viruses. You cannot tell the difference between these illnesses by symptoms alone. Talk to a healthcare provider about getting tested for COVID-19/Flu/RSV if you have symptoms and are at higher risk of …

WebMay 13, 2024 · Omicron: The Omicron (B.1.1.529 and BA lineages) variant was first identified in the U.S. on December 1, 2024, in California and confirmed in Washington state December 4, 2024.Omicron spreads more easily than other variants and is currently the predominant strain in Washington State.
